/*
 *  aes.h
 *  CommonCrypto shoefly for compatability with older versions
 *
 */

#ifdef CC_Building
#include "CommonCryptor.h"
#include "CommonCryptorSPI.h"
#include "CommonCryptorPriv.h"
#else
#include <CommonCrypto/CommonCryptor.h>
#include <CommonCrypto/CommonCryptorSPI.h>
#endif /* CC_Building */

#if !defined( _CC_AES_H_ )
#define _CC_AES_H_

#if defined(__cplusplus)
extern "C" {
#endif	
    
#define AES_BLOCK_SIZE  16  /* the AES block size in bytes          */
    
typedef struct
{
	CCCryptorRef	cref;
	uint32_t		ctx[kCCContextSizeAES128/4];
} aes_encrypt_ctx;
    
typedef struct
{
	CCCryptorRef	cref;
	uint32_t		ctx[kCCContextSizeAES128/4];
} aes_decrypt_ctx;
    
    
    
void aes_encrypt_key128(const unsigned char *in_key, aes_encrypt_ctx cx[1])
__OSX_AVAILABLE_BUT_DEPRECATED(__MAC_10_4, __MAC_10_7, __IPHONE_5_0, __IPHONE_5_0);

void aes_encrypt_key192(const unsigned char *key, aes_encrypt_ctx cx[1])
__OSX_AVAILABLE_BUT_DEPRECATED(__MAC_10_4, __MAC_10_7, __IPHONE_5_0, __IPHONE_5_0);

void aes_encrypt_key256(const unsigned char *in_key, aes_encrypt_ctx cx[1])
__OSX_AVAILABLE_BUT_DEPRECATED(__MAC_10_4, __MAC_10_7, __IPHONE_5_0, __IPHONE_5_0);

void aes_encrypt_cbc(const unsigned char *in_blk, const unsigned char *in_iv, unsigned int num_blk,
                         unsigned char *out_blk, aes_encrypt_ctx cx[1])
__OSX_AVAILABLE_BUT_DEPRECATED(__MAC_10_4, __MAC_10_7, __IPHONE_5_0, __IPHONE_5_0);

void aes_decrypt_key128(const unsigned char *in_key, aes_decrypt_ctx cx[1])
__OSX_AVAILABLE_BUT_DEPRECATED(__MAC_10_4, __MAC_10_7, __IPHONE_5_0, __IPHONE_5_0);

void aes_decrypt_key192(const unsigned char *key, aes_decrypt_ctx cx[1])
__OSX_AVAILABLE_BUT_DEPRECATED(__MAC_10_4, __MAC_10_7, __IPHONE_5_0, __IPHONE_5_0);

void aes_decrypt_key256(const unsigned char *in_key, aes_decrypt_ctx cx[1])
__OSX_AVAILABLE_BUT_DEPRECATED(__MAC_10_4, __MAC_10_7, __IPHONE_5_0, __IPHONE_5_0);

void aes_decrypt_cbc(const unsigned char *in_blk, const unsigned char *in_iv, unsigned int num_blk,
                         unsigned char *out_blk, aes_decrypt_ctx cx[1])
__OSX_AVAILABLE_BUT_DEPRECATED(__MAC_10_4, __MAC_10_7, __IPHONE_5_0, __IPHONE_5_0);


#if defined(__cplusplus)
}
#endif


#endif	/* _CC_AES_H_ */
